    What Exactly is a Tesla Model Y Juniper Wheel Cap?

    So, what exactly is a wheel cap, and why is it important? Well, the wheel cap is the decorative cover that sits over the center of your Tesla Model Y's wheel. It's also known as a center cap. It serves a dual purpose: first, it enhances the appearance of your wheels by covering the often-utilitarian look of the lug nuts and the wheel's center; and second, it protects those essential components from the elements, such as rain, snow, and road debris. The "Juniper" in the name refers to the specific design and style of the wheel cap, which is tailored for the Model Y vehicle. The Tesla Model Y Juniper wheel cap is designed to fit the specific dimensions and aesthetic of the Model Y, ensuring a seamless and stylish look. These caps are typically made from durable materials that can withstand the rigors of daily driving. The design and finish of the wheel cap can vary, adding a touch of personality to your car's overall appearance. Different finishes, like matte black or metallic silver, can further customize the look, allowing you to match your car's style or create a contrasting effect. The primary function is to protect the wheel hub and lug nuts from corrosion and damage. Over time, these caps can become damaged, lost, or simply worn out due to exposure to the elements and everyday use.

    Installation Guide: How to Replace Your Tesla Model Y Juniper Wheel Cap

    Installing or replacing your Tesla Model Y Juniper wheel cap is a relatively simple process that you can often do yourself. To begin, gather your supplies. You'll need the new wheel caps, a soft cloth, and a small, flat-head screwdriver or a specialized wheel cap removal tool (highly recommended to prevent damage). First, locate the small hole or indentation on the edge of the existing wheel cap. This is where you'll insert the screwdriver or removal tool. Gently insert the screwdriver or removal tool into the hole and carefully pry the wheel cap away from the wheel. Be gentle to avoid scratching the wheel or damaging the cap. Once the cap is loosened, pull it straight out. Clean the wheel hub area with a soft cloth to remove any dirt or debris. This ensures a proper fit for the new cap. Align the new wheel cap with the wheel hub. Push the cap firmly into place until it snaps securely into position. You should hear a clicking sound, indicating that it's properly installed. Ensure the cap is flush with the wheel and that it's seated properly. If the cap doesn't fit correctly, remove it and try again, making sure it's aligned properly. After installation, take a quick spin to ensure the caps are secure and that the wheels are balanced. This is a crucial step!     Maintenance and Care Tips for Your Wheel Caps

    Keeping your Tesla Model Y Juniper wheel caps looking their best requires some simple maintenance and care. Regularly wash your wheel caps with mild soap and water to remove dirt, brake dust, and other debris. Use a soft sponge or cloth to avoid scratching the surface.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the finish of the wheel caps. If you live in an area with harsh weather conditions, consider applying a protectant coating to your wheel caps. This will help protect them from UV rays, road salt, and other elements that can cause damage. Inspect your wheel caps regularly for any signs of damage, such as cracks, chips, or fading. Address these issues promptly to prevent further deterioration. If you notice any loose or missing wheel caps, replace them as soon as possible to protect the wheel hub and maintain the car's appearance. Check the fit of the wheel caps periodically to ensure they remain secure. A loose cap can fall off while driving, so it's best to check them regularly. If you need to remove your wheel caps for any reason, be sure to use the proper tools and techniques to avoid damaging them. When storing your wheel caps, keep them in a clean,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.     Common Problems and Troubleshooting

    Sometimes, you might run into a few issues with your Tesla Model Y Juniper wheel caps. One common problem is a loose wheel cap. If your cap isn't fitting snugly, it could be due to a damaged clip or a poor fit. In this case, you might need to replace the cap or the clips that secure it. If the wheel caps are damaged or missing, such as cracks, chips, or fading, they should be replaced to maintain the appearance and protect the wheels. Another common issue is damage from road debris. If your wheel caps have been exposed to harsh conditions, they may show signs of wear and tear, such as scratches or dents. Regular cleaning and maintenance can help minimize these issues. If the wheel caps become difficult to remove, it might be due to a buildup of dirt and grime. In such cases, use a specialized removal tool or carefully pry them off with a screwdriver. Be gentle to avoid damaging the wheels. If you're having trouble installing the new wheel caps, make sure you're aligning them correctly and applying enough pressure to snap them into place. If they still won't fit, double-check that you have the correct size and type of cap for your wheels. In case of any problems, refer to the manufacturer's instructions or consult a professional.
